OpenRouter
API keys, models, and spend: everything you need to know.
What is OpenRouter?
OpenRouter is a model routing API that gives you access to hundreds of AI models from Google, OpenAI, Anthropic, DeepSeek, and others through a single account and API key. You pay only for what you use at each provider's rate.
Coffee Coach AI uses your personal OpenRouter account. Your roast telemetry goes directly from your computer to OpenRouter and then to the model provider.
Your roast data stays yours. Coffee Coach AI has no servers and no Coffee Coach account. We never receive, store, sell, or see your roast data. We could not anyway: nothing is sent to us or transmitted to us, and we have no visibility into your data at all, ever.
Getting your API key
- 1Create a free account at openrouter.ai
- 2Go to Keys in your dashboard
- 3Click Create key and name it “Coffee Coach AI”
- 4Copy the key (starts with
sk-or-v1-…) - 5Paste it into the Coffee Coach AI onboarding wizard or Settings screen
- 6Coffee Coach AI validates it before storing it in the macOS Keychain or Windows Credential Locker
Your key is secured in the macOS Keychain or Windows Credential Locker and is used only for OpenRouter API calls. It is never sent to Coffee Coach AI because there is no Coffee Coach AI server to receive it.
Controlling your spend
In your OpenRouter account, go to Settings → Limits and set a monthly credit cap. Once hit, API calls stop until you raise the limit or the month resets.
OpenRouter's dashboard shows token usage and cost per model and per request.
A 12-minute roast (~48 API calls) costs less than $0.01 with Gemini 2.5 Flash Lite. Daily roasting for a month is unlikely to exceed $0.50.
Recommended models
These models are marked as recommended in the Coffee Coach AI Settings model picker.
| Model | Best for | Est. cost/roast | Notes |
|---|---|---|---|
Google Gemini 2.5 Flash Lite Default | Daily roasting | < $0.01 | Fastest, cheapest, strong reasoning. Default for a reason. |
OpenAI GPT-4.1 Nano Recommended | Alternative | ~$0.01 | Slightly different coaching voice, comparable cost. |
DeepSeek V3.2 Recommended | Budget power users | < $0.01 | Surprisingly capable at very low cost. |
Google Gemma 3n E2B Recommended | Experimentation | < $0.01 | Fast and compact; less consistent on nuanced RoR reasoning. |
Fastest, cheapest, strong reasoning. Default for a reason.
Slightly different coaching voice, comparable cost.
Surprisingly capable at very low cost.
Fast and compact; less consistent on nuanced RoR reasoning.
Other models
For live coaching: pick a model that responds in under 3 seconds and costs under $0.05/roast. Gemini 2.5 Flash Lite is the default for a reason. For post-roast analysis, use whatever gives the richest output, since latency doesn't matter.
Ready to get started? Create your OpenRouter account, then download Coffee Coach AI for Mac or Windows.